St. Joseph Oratory in Detroit named Archdiocesan Shrine

St. Joseph Oratory in Detroit named Archdiocesan Shrine

On Sunday, March 8, 2020, Detroit Archbishop Allen H. Vigneron announced that he has granted the title of Archdiocesan Shrine to St. Joseph Oratory, in recognition of the parish’s service as a popular place of pilgrimage and its abundant availability of the sacraments.
